Just read :
>Dina mis-stated the problem. The fax I got from Microsoft, through
>Globalcenter (the people we get our internet connection from) said:
>
>"Microsoft has received information that the domain listed above, which
>appears to be on servers under your control, is offering unlicensed copies
>oris engaged in other unauthorized activites relating to copyrighted
>computer programs published by Microsoft.
>
>1. Identification of copyrighted works:
>
>Computer Programs
>Windows 98
>Frontpage 98
>Publisher
>Age of Empires
>
>Copyright owners
>Microsoft
>
>2. Infringing material or activity found at the following locations:
>http://66.36.228.12 http://www.woodmann.net/fravia/project9.htm
>http://www.woodmann.net/fravia/twd_aeo.htm
>
>The above location is offering 'Cracks' or 'Serial Numbers', inteded to
>circumvent protection applied to prevent the unauthorized copying and use of
>copyrighted computer programs, for distribution by technical means."
>
>And then there's more that's irrelevant.
>
>That's why we took your site offline.
>
>
>Thanks,
>
**********
Ok, the essays were removed from the mirror. Now, don't even think to publish an essay concerning adding functionnality to msdos 2.0
Sorry for the inconvenience, one good news, woodmann (our great sponsor) took a two year domain account for this place to stay alive.
We're still here to last for a very long time, merry christmas.
